Currently, the ability of human resources greatly determines the success of a company in achieving its goals. The purpose of this study is to determine the influence of work discipline, transformational leadership style, and job training on employee performance at Bank Kalteng Tamiang Layang. This study used quantitative methods with an associational descriptive approach using questionnaires as a data measuring tool. The population in this study amounted to 32 employees. Sampling technique using non-probability sampling. Data analysis in this study consisted of multiple linear regression analysis and hypothesis testing using SPSS application. The results of this study are known that the work discipline variable has a significance value of 0.848. The Transformational Leadership Style variable has a significance value of 0.255. The job training variable has a significance value of 0.192. So it can be concluded that work discipline, transformational leadership style, and job training have a positive and significant effect on employee performance at Bank Kalteng Tamiang Layang.
